The Nutritional Breakdown of Impossible Burgers
Impossible Burgers have become a popular choice for those seeking a meat alternative without sacrificing flavor or texture. But how do they stack up nutritionally against traditional beef burgers? The Impossible Burger is primarily made from soy protein, coconut oil, sunflower oil, and heme, a molecule that gives it the “meaty” taste and appearance.
A standard 4-ounce Impossible Burger patty contains roughly 240 calories, 19 grams of protein, 14 grams of fat (of which 8 grams are saturated fat), and 370 milligrams of sodium. Compared to a typical beef patty of similar size, the Impossible Burger usually has slightly less saturated fat and cholesterol-free content since it’s plant-based.
The protein content is comparable, making it a viable option for those wanting to maintain muscle mass or meet daily protein needs. However, the fat profile is different; the burger uses coconut oil for fat, which is high in saturated fat. Saturated fat intake is often linked to heart health concerns when consumed excessively.
Additionally, the sodium level in an Impossible Burger is higher than that found in many traditional burgers. This might be problematic for individuals monitoring their salt intake due to hypertension or cardiovascular risks.
Key Nutrients in Impossible Burgers vs. Beef
The table below highlights the main nutritional components of an Impossible Burger compared to a standard beef burger:
| Nutrient | Impossible Burger (4 oz) | Beef Burger (4 oz) |
|---|---|---|
| Calories | 240 kcal | 290 kcal |
| Protein | 19 g | 22 g |
| Total Fat | 14 g | 23 g |
| Saturated Fat | 8 g | 9 g |
| Cholesterol | 0 mg | 80 mg |
| Sodium | 370 mg | 75 mg |
This comparison shows that while the Impossible Burger contains no cholesterol and fewer calories overall, its sodium content is significantly higher. This should be considered by anyone sensitive to salt consumption.
The Role of Heme and Its Health Implications
A standout ingredient in Impossible Burgers is soy leghemoglobin—commonly called heme—which imparts the burger’s distinctive bloody color and meaty flavor. Heme is an iron-containing molecule naturally found in animal muscle tissue but sourced from genetically engineered yeast for the burger.
Heme’s inclusion has stirred debate about health effects. Some studies suggest that excessive heme iron consumption from red meat may increase oxidative stress and promote inflammation linked to cancer risks. However, the heme in Impossible Burgers comes from plants via fermentation rather than animal blood.
Research on plant-derived heme remains limited but indicates lower potential harm compared to animal heme. Still, critics argue that because this ingredient is novel and produced via genetic engineering, long-term health effects are not fully understood yet.
For most people, moderate consumption of heme-containing plant-based foods like Impossible Burgers is unlikely to cause immediate issues. But those with iron overload conditions or specific sensitivities should consult healthcare providers before making it a staple.
Coconut Oil Saturated Fat: Friend or Foe?
Coconut oil supplies much of the fat in an Impossible Burger. It’s rich in saturated fats called medium-chain triglycerides (MCTs). Unlike long-chain saturated fats found predominantly in animal products, MCTs metabolize differently—potentially offering quicker energy use rather than storage as body fat.
However, research remains divided on whether coconut oil’s saturated fats are heart-healthy or harmful at typical dietary levels. Some studies highlight improved HDL (“good”) cholesterol with coconut oil intake; others warn about raising LDL (“bad”) cholesterol when consumed excessively.
The bottom line: eating an Impossible Burger occasionally as part of a balanced diet likely won’t pose major heart risks. But relying heavily on processed foods with coconut oil might not be ideal for cardiovascular health over time.
Processing Level: How “Natural” Is the Impossible Burger?
One criticism frequently raised about Impossible Burgers is their degree of processing. Unlike whole-food plant options such as beans or lentils, these burgers undergo extensive refinement steps involving genetically modified organisms (GMOs), fermentation processes, and added flavor enhancers.
Critics argue that highly processed foods often contain additives like preservatives, stabilizers, flavorings, and colorants that may impact gut health or trigger sensitivities in some individuals.
On the flip side, proponents emphasize that food technology allows creation of products mimicking meat’s taste and texture while reducing environmental strain caused by livestock farming.
From a health standpoint, minimally processed whole foods generally provide more fiber and micronutrients beneficial for digestion and chronic disease prevention than ultra-processed alternatives like plant-based burgers.
If you’re aiming for optimal health through whole diets rich in fruits, vegetables, nuts, seeds, legumes—Impossible Burgers should be considered an occasional treat rather than daily fare.
Soy Protein: Benefits and Concerns
Soy protein isolates form the backbone of Impossible Burgers’ protein content. Soy has been extensively studied for its potential benefits: lowering LDL cholesterol levels modestly; providing all essential amino acids; supporting muscle maintenance; and offering antioxidant compounds called isoflavones with possible cancer-protective effects.
However, soy also raises questions regarding phytoestrogens—plant compounds mimicking estrogen hormones—which some worry could disrupt endocrine function if consumed excessively over time.
Current evidence shows moderate soy intake does not adversely affect hormone balance in most adults; it may even benefit postmenopausal women by alleviating symptoms related to estrogen decline.
Still, individuals with soy allergies must avoid these burgers altogether due to risk of severe reactions.
The Sodium Factor: Hidden Danger?
Sodium content in processed foods often flies under the radar but plays a crucial role in cardiovascular health risks such as hypertension and stroke. The average sodium per serving in an Impossible Burger (around 370 mg) exceeds that found in many unprocessed meats by several folds.
For comparison:
- A standard grilled chicken breast (~4 oz) contains roughly 70-80 mg sodium.
- A fresh beef patty usually has under 100 mg before seasoning.
- The high sodium count mostly comes from added salts and flavor enhancers used during manufacturing.
If you’re eating multiple processed items daily or already have high blood pressure concerns, these hidden salts can add up quickly—negating any benefits from lower cholesterol or reduced saturated fat elsewhere.
Choosing fresh ingredients combined with homemade seasonings generally offers better control over sodium intake than relying heavily on pre-made patties like the Impossible Burger.
